Hannah Miley believes her success in winning silver at the World Championships can be the springboard to glory at the London Olympics.

Miley won her first World Championship medal with silver at the 2011 event in Shanghai.

She said: "The World Championships are the next closest event to the Olympics, it's pretty much the same people. It's a really good stepping stone for me.

"I've been working on this for most of my career, and must make sure I continue to work as hard as I can. I can't control what anyone else does

"I think the team overall did really well, everyone felt really positive.

"What happens in this doesn't mean the the same result will happen at the Olympics, but people now have an idea what to do. They can use it as a driving force."
